Blind spot module calibration - Blind spot mobile calibration is a service that uses specialized equipment and trained technicians to calibrate a vehicle's blind spot monitor (BSM). The BSM uses sensors to detect vehicles in the blind spot and provide visual or audible warnings. Accurate BSM sensor angles can help drivers be more aware of their surroundings and improve safety.

Front radar calibration - Front radar calibration, also known as ADAS calibration, is a procedure that can be performed statically in a shop or dynamically while driving a vehicle. The calibration process involves using a scan tool to aim the radar at targets and may require the use of a reflector plate. The calibration may need to be redone after a crash or if other services are performed on the vehicle, such as wheel alignment or suspension work.

Windshield camera & sensor calibration -Windshield sensor calibration is the process of adjusting the sensors and cameras in a vehicle's windshield to ensure they work properly. This is important because these sensors and cameras are part of the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S) that include features like lane departure warnings, automatic emergency braking, and adaptive cruise control.
